Hi, I am about to be approved for a CP. Then after that there is the 15 day waiting period to make sure all is good.

However, I have a company credit card. I am not the primary card holder. The owner is the primary card holder and all employees have one. I was told by my trustee and the credit agency I reached out that this wouldn't be an issue. I just want to make sure that this is accurate.

From my reading, you can use the company credit card, or any credit card, as long as you are not the primary card holder. Someone else is responsible for paying the bill and for the care of the card.
